Market Overview
The global off-road trailers market is witnessing significant growth and is expected to continue its upward trajectory in the coming years. Off-road trailers are specially designed trailers that are built to withstand rough terrains and provide a comfortable and convenient camping experience. These trailers are equipped with features such as heavy-duty suspension systems, off-road tires, and robust chassis to ensure durability and stability in challenging environments.
Meaning
Off-road trailers are recreational vehicles that offer a unique way to explore the great outdoors. They provide a mobile living space for outdoor enthusiasts, allowing them to venture into remote areas while enjoying the comforts of home. These trailers are specifically designed to navigate rough and uneven terrains, including dirt roads, rocky paths, and off-road trails.

Category-wise Insights
- Pop-up Trailers: Pop-up trailers, also known as tent trailers or folding campers, are compact and lightweight trailers that can be expanded when parked. These trailers offer a good balance between affordability, ease of towing, and camping comfort. They are popular among camping enthusiasts looking for a cost-effective and versatile camping solution.
- Teardrop Trailers: Teardrop trailers are small, aerodynamic trailers resembling a teardrop shape. They are designed to provide basic sleeping accommodations and kitchen facilities while maintaining a compact and lightweight form factor. Teardrop trailers are ideal for solo or couple camping trips and are known for their retro appeal and fuel efficiency.
- Toy Haulers: Toy haulers are off-road trailers specifically designed to carry recreational vehicles (RVs), such as ATVs, motorcycles, or small boats. These trailers feature a separate garage area at the rear, allowing users to transport their outdoor toys while still providing living space and amenities. Toy haulers cater to adventure enthusiasts who want to combine camping with their recreational activities.
- Expedition Trailers: Expedition trailers are rugged and robust trailers built for extreme off-road adventures and long-term camping trips. These trailers offer advanced off-road capabilities, ample storage space, and heavy-duty construction to withstand harsh environments. Expedition trailers are favored by overlanders and outdoor enthusiasts seeking to explore remote and challenging terrains.

Covid-19 Impact
The Covid-19 pandemic had a significant impact on the off-road trailers market. While the travel and tourism industry faced unprecedented challenges, the off-road trailers market experienced a surge in demand as people sought safe and socially distanced outdoor recreational activities. The pandemic accelerated the shift towards domestic travel and outdoor adventures, with off-road trailers providing a self-contained and controlled environment for camping and exploration.
Consumers turned to off-road trailers as a means to escape crowded destinations and maintain a sense of security during uncertain times. The ability to travel to remote areas and have a self-sufficient accommodation option became particularly appealing. However, supply chain disruptions and manufacturing challenges during lockdowns affected the production and availability of off-road trailers.
The pandemic also led to an increased emphasis on cleanliness, hygiene, and sanitization. Manufacturers incorporated features such as improved ventilation systems, antimicrobial surfaces, and easy-to-clean materials to address these concerns and provide peace of mind to customers.
Overall, the Covid-19 pandemic acted as a catalyst for the off-road trailers market, driving the demand for outdoor experiences and self-contained travel options. As the world recovers from the pandemic, the market is expected to continue its growth trajectory, albeit with potential shifts in consumer preferences and priorities.
